On April 2, 2025, Pakistan People's Party (PPP) activists staged a peaceful protest in Sohrab Goth, Karachi, opposing federal government plans to construct six new canals on the Indus River. The demonstration occurred in Sindh province, where water rights disputes frequently arise between federal and provincial authorities.

If water infrastructure protests expand beyond this localized demonstration, agricultural production in Sindh province could face disruptions, as the region relies heavily on Indus River irrigation for major crops including cotton, rice, and wheat.
